Default Water inside

I have a 2003 Disco. Recently I have had a problem when it rains. Water will drip into the cab from both the front seatbelt holders and the top center console where the sunroof switches are. Is there a possible drain plug stopped up or what might it be? If it is a drain issue where would I possibly locate it?

If it's not the drain tubes, it's the flange seal. Either way, you'll need to drop the headliner to address the issue.
